Job description

  • Presenting – Prepare high-quality client presentations and lead integration discovery and requirement gathering sessions, translating business needs into clear integration scope.
  • Integration landscape –Understand the AS IS integration landscape, data flows, and system architecture. Work with key client stakeholders to define the TO BE integration strategy and target architecture.
  • Own the MuleSoft integration and API architecture design using API-led connectivity principles (Experience, Process, and System layers).
  • Work with delivery and technical colleagues to transform client requirements into best practice MuleSoft Anypoint Platform solutions.
  • Produce and maintain Solution Design Documents, API specifications (RAML/OAS), and data mapping artefacts.
  • Development & Configuration
    • Develop and configure MuleSoft integrations (Mule flows, connectors, DataWeave transformations) in line with the solution design, delegating build tasks to the development team where appropriate.
  • Testing – Define integration testing strategies, support internal testing activities (unit, integration, end-to-end), and support client UAT.
  • Training – Where needed run workshops to upskill client teams and Administrators on Anypoint Platform usage, API management, and integration monitoring.
  • Client relationship – Engage with client stakeholders at all levels to analyse business processes, integration requirements, and data flows, building trust as a subject matter expert.
  • Growth – Support pre-sales team with identifying future opportunities.
  • Travel – A willingness to travel as and when required.
Technical Skills:
  • 5+ years of MuleSoft / integration project delivery experience, end to end, with strong organisation skills.
  • Degree educated or equivalent strong practical experience within an enterprise integration delivery environment.
  • Deep expertise in the MuleSoft Anypoint Platform, including
    • Anypoint Studio and Anypoint Exchange
    • API Manager (policies, rate limiting, SLA tiers, client applications)
    • Runtime Manager and CloudHub 1.0 / CloudHub 2.0 / Runtime Fabric deployment
    • Anypoint MQ for asynchronous messaging and event-driven integration
    • Object Store v2 for stateful processing
  • Strong DataWeave 2.0 skills including complex transformations, batch processing, custom modules, and performance optimisation.
  • Proven experience with API-led connectivity (Experience, Process, System layers) and RESTful / SOAP API design and documentation (RAML / OAS 3.0).
  • Experience integrating with Salesforce using the Salesforce Connector, Streaming API, Platform Events, and Bulk API.
  • Experience integrating with ERP and enterprise systems (e.g. SAP, Oracle, Microsoft Dynamics).
  • Familiarity with common integration patterns: pub/sub, event-driven architecture, batch processing, orchestration, and scatter-gather.
  • Experience with CI/CD tooling for MuleSoft deployments (Maven, Jenkins, Azure DevOps, GitHub Actions).
  • Preferred:
    • MuleSoft Certified Developer (Level 1 or Level 2)
    • MuleSoft Certified Integration Architect
    • Experience with MuleSoft Accelerators and pre-built integration templates
    • Exposure to Salesforce ecosystem (Sales Cloud, Service Cloud, Revenue Cloud)
